Switching Characteristics—2.5-V Supply

VCC1 = VCC2 = 2.5 V ± 10% (over recommended operating conditions unless otherwise noted)
PARAMETER TEST CONDITIONS MIN TYP MAX UNIT
tPLH, tPHL Propagation delay time See Figure 23-1 7.5 12 21 ns
PWD Pulse width distortion(1) |tPHL – tPLH| 0.2 5.9 ns
tsk(pp) Part-to-part skew time(2) 4.6 ns
tr Output signal rise time See Figure 23-1 1 3.5 ns
tf Output signal fall time 1 3.5 ns
tDO Default output delay time from input power loss Measured from the time VCC1 goes
below 1.7V. See Figure 23-2
0.1 0.3 μs
tie Time interval error 216 – 1 PRBS data at 100 Mbps 1 ns
Also known as pulse skew.
tsk(pp) is the magnitude of the difference in propagation delay times between any terminals of different devices switching in the same direction while operating at identical supply voltages, temperature, input signals and loads.
